1

404模板i18n不能翻译的问题

模板kevin1073 次浏览

如果是用户自己在控制器抛出c.NotFound()模板是可以正常翻译的,

如果是框架自身捕获的,是否翻译消息,与过滤器栈中i18n的位置有关,只要框架执行到了i18n过滤器就可以正常翻译。所以可以将118n过滤器的位置调整到前面来临时解决404模板不翻译的问题。

 

ps:这个有bug,没有做权限控制啊。可以随意编辑他人的帖子呢。而且还没有记录编辑人的信息。。。。。

 

共1个回复
admin 回复

靠,果然如齿,